Utica, NY (WIBX) - The James Street murder trial is in its 2nd day. The suspect, 30-year-old Marshall Jackson, a U.S. Army Veteran, is facing a 2nd Degree Murder charge. UPD Investigators say he fired the fatal shots that ended the life of 24-year-old Anthony Garner. In court today, a UPD Crime Scene Unit Investigator described evidence found on the victim and the suspect.

The shooting occurred last year, during the early morning hours of May 25th on James Street. Officials say the victim was celebrating his 24th birthday. In court today, prosecutors showed jurors a surveillance video, supposedly, showing Jackson and two unidentified subjects, chasing the victim. Prosecutors say the video also shows Jackson shooting Garner in the back, the left side of his body and his forehead. The trail is still underway in Oneida County Court.
